git(码云)的使用:线上代码和线下代码的统一

一的.ssh公钥的生成

1.先在码云上面建一个项目的私有仓库,打开码云的设置选项,选中SSH公钥选项

git(码云)的使用:线上代码和线下代码的统一_第1张图片

2.公钥的生成:

b必须得先安装好git,验证电脑上是否安装好git可以直接通过cmd敲git --version的命令来查看git版本,同时也可以版本来验证电脑是否安装了git,如果是已经安装好了的,(window系统的)可以右击左面进入git bash,就开始命令的输入:

先输入:ssh-keygen -t rsa -C [email protected]”(邮箱地址要更改,邮箱最好填GitHub注册的邮箱)

然后回车三次再输入:cat ~/.ssh/id_rsa.pub

就可以获取到公钥了,然后填进公钥里面点击确定可以了

3.把线上代码下载下来

在之前建立的仓库里面打开,把代码下载下来,记得要选SSH,然后点击复制

git(码云)的使用:线上代码和线下代码的统一_第2张图片

这样就可以在本地指定的位置打开git bash输入命令  git clone 上面复制的项目链接   

然后回车就可以了,指定的位置上面就会多出一个文件,在那个文件上面添加自己的项目就行了(本人的是vue的项目)

二。提交项目到码云上面

1.提交代码到线上

git status是查看项目的状态情况

首先输入git add。

然后输入git commit -m'project'   (其中project一般写成要提交的项目的备注)

再输入git push

三步就可以把代码提交到线上了,本人在输入那三步中遇到两个问题,一个是报用户信息没绑定(

Please tell me who you are

后面通过百度找的答案

it config --global user.email "[email protected](你的邮箱地址)"

 git config --global user.name "Your Name(你的名字)"

还有另外一个错误是也是通过百度直接输入git init就可以了

2。建立git 分支

点击分支


输入分支的名字

git(码云)的使用:线上代码和线下代码的统一_第3张图片

然后线上就有分支了,但本地并没有,所以的本地也弄一个也要弄到本地

首先输入git pull

再输入git checkout 分支名

这样就可以对项目进行编译了

编写完成之后想把代码继续提交到线上的话就还是和上面一样三步走

git add。=> git commit -m'project'

接下来就得对项目分支进行合并到主支

首先git checkout master

然后git merge origin / index-swiper  (index-swiper 就是分支的名称)

最后git push

就可以实现分支的合并了



你可能感兴趣的:(工具的使用)